TY - JOUR TI - New solutions to the charged current B-anomalies DO - https://doi.org/doi:10.7282/t3-yhaa-dm09 PY - 2019 AB - There are a host of different experimental efforts looking for signs of physics beyond the Standard Model. For the most part, the results from these experiments are in agreement with the Standard Model prediction. Nonetheless, a handful of discrepancies have been observed. One of the most significant discrepancies is observed in the flavor-changing processes B → DTV and B → D*TV. In this work we propose two novel explanations for these anomalies and study their phenomenology. The characteristic feature of these two models are (i) use of right-handed neutrinos and a new W' mediator, and (ii) mixing between two leptoquarks after the electroweak symmetry breaking, respectively. We further study the imprint of these models, as well as all other viable solutions, on related asymmetry observables. We motivate the measurement of various asymmetry observables associated with the T lepton in these processes, as they can likely distinguish different viable solutions.
